Cheap(ish) SSD's for EXSi datastores by CrispyCashew in homelab

[–]MrSizzleSocks 0 points1 point  (0 children)

Onboard (fake) Raid 1 as I don't have a raid card in my build. If I could find a decent one for a reasonable proce I'd be all over it. But It does run really well for my useage.

I currently have windows server 2016 as the host.

Ubuntu 16.04 (VM) running emby, sick rage, couch potato, transmission and htpc manager.

Cent os 7 (VM) running guacamole Windows server 2016 (VM) running A custom Minecraft server along with a Rust server and an Ark server.

I'm Wanting to seperate the vms a little maybe move emby to its own vm and each game server to have a dedicated vm but wanting to get more ssd's to do raid 10 or a large raid 5.

Cheap(ish) SSD's for EXSi datastores by CrispyCashew in homelab

[–]MrSizzleSocks 0 points1 point  (0 children)

Iv currently have a e31245v5 with 32GB crucial ecc memory with a 128GB ssd for boot and 2 256GB SSD's mirrored for vm storage.

My DS 1815+ has a 6x4TB raid 6 array that I share to my PC's and VM's. And is backed up to my DS415+ which is a 6TB and 2x2TB in jbod

I have just ordered another 32GB's of RAM for my server along with the new SSD's that will be my boot drive. Most of my gear was purchased from PC Case Gear as shopping around would only save a few bucks here and there. I would have liked to get something a bit better than the 750 EVO's but I figured for their price they will work perfectly for my needs
